Geo Location Information for 61.91.12.141 IP Address. The IP Address 61.91.12.141 is located at 13.7904 latitude and 100.57 longitude in Thailand. Friendly Location for the IP Address is Krung Thep Maha Nakhon, Din Daeng, Thailand, 10400
SBI Thai Online สะดวกสบาย ด้วยบริการที่เหนือกว่า